Annotation
An ancient people have been made into slaves, forced into a life of endless servitude and labour. The King has ordered that all their male children be slaughtered to make sure it stays that way. But, one boy, Moses, survives, hidden in a basket on a riverbank. He will rise up to demand that the King lets his people go.
